IT Support Jobs in Utah

IT Support jobs in Utah are concentrated in Salt Lake City, Provo, and Ogden, where a dense mix of tech companies, financial services firms, and university systems generates steady demand at every level from help desk to senior systems administrator. Major employers with lasting Utah footprints include Adobe, Goldman Sachs, and Intermountain Health, all of which maintain large internal IT teams. What Utah Employers Look For

The qualifications that appear most often in IT support jobs across Utah.

  • CompTIA A+ or equivalent entry-level certification recognized by Utah employers
  • Experience supporting Windows and macOS environments in a corporate or enterprise setting
  • Proficiency with ticketing systems such as ServiceNow, Jira, or Zendesk
  • Familiarity with Active Directory, Microsoft 365, and network troubleshooting protocols
  • Strong verbal communication skills for end-user support across technical and non-technical staff
  • Associate or bachelor's degree in information technology, computer science, or a related field

IT Support Jobs in Utah: Frequently Asked Questions

How do you become an it support in Utah?

Most Utah employers expect at least a CompTIA A+ certification and a two- or four-year degree in information technology or a related field, though neither is state-licensed. The practical path starts with an associate degree from institutions like Salt Lake Community College or Utah Valley University, followed by an entry-level help desk role. Building skills in cloud platforms, Active Directory, and ticketing systems makes candidates competitive for mid-level positions at Utah's major tech and healthcare employers.

Are there remote it support jobs in Utah?

Yes, but they're less common than in purely desk-based fields because much of it support work requires on-site hardware troubleshooting and hands-on device management. About 29% of it support openings tied to Utah are remote or hybrid as of September 2026, and those positions tend to focus on cloud administration, software support, and tier-two helpdesk roles that can be handled without physical access to equipment.

How can I get hired as an it support in Utah with little or no experience?

The most realistic entry point is a help desk or desktop support role, which large Utah employers in healthcare and finance regularly fill with candidates who hold a CompTIA A+ and have completed a two-year program at Salt Lake Community College, Utah Valley University, or Dixie Technical College. Intermountain Health and several Salt Lake City-area financial services firms run structured IT apprenticeship or rotational programs aimed at early-career candidates. Moving into it support from adjacent roles like office coordinator or AV technician is also a common path when paired with a vendor certification.
